If MacDuffie was feeling good fresh off their 3-0 takedown of Eagle Hill last Wednesday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The MacDuffie Mustangs came up short against the Mount St. Charles Academy Mounties on Saturday, falling 3-0.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Mustangs of the 3-0 loss they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in October.
While MacDuffie was not able to make it on the board, they still kept things close, especially in the third set. The final score came out to 25-15, 25-14, 25-23.
Sophia Baeta was a one-man wrecking crew for Mount St. Charles Academy as she had seven aces and five digs.
MacDuffie's defeat was their seventh stra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 1-9. As for Mount St. Charles Academy, the victory (which was their fifth in a row) raised their record to 16-4.
MacDuffie will head out to face off against Eagle Hill at 4:15 p.m. on Monday. As for Mount St. Charles Academy, they will welcome Worcester Academy at 5:15 p.m. on Wednesday.
